The 1.39% decline in FTS coincides with a session that saw normal-to-moderate trading volume compared to recent averages, suggesting that the selloff is orderly rather than driven by panic. Sector positioning may be playing a role, as utilities often experience rotation when investors shift toward more cyclical or growth-oriented areas. In the current environment, rising Treasury yields could be making income-oriented stocks like utilities relatively less attractive on a yield basis. Fortis, known for its stable dividend and regulated operations, has historically been a defensive holding, but short-term price action sometimes reflects broader market sentiment changes. The absence of company-specific headlines indicates that the move is likely tied to macroeconomic factors, such as interest rate expectations or shifts in risk appetite. With the utility sector generally perceived as a bond proxy, any increase in long-term yield expectations may weigh on valuations. The 1.39% decline is contained relative to larger intraday moves seen in the sector over the past several weeks, implying that sellers are not aggressively pushing the stock lower. Volume patterns do not suggest institutional distribution on a significant scale, but continued monitoring of sector flows will be important. The current price of $55.33 places FTS in the middle of its recent trading range, leaving room for either continuation or reversal depending on the next catalyst.

From a technical perspective, Fortis has established clear boundaries with support at $52.56 and resistance at $58.10. The stock’s current price of $55.33 sits roughly midway between these two levels, which implies a neutral short-term posture. Momentum indicators, such as the Relative Strength Index, may be in the mid-40s range, reflecting a mild bearish bias but not oversold territory. Price action over the past several weeks has shown a series of lower highs, a pattern that could indicate a modest downtrend. However, the recent decline does not break below any critical moving averages; the stock may be testing its 50-day moving average if it is in the vicinity of $55.30–$55.50, but this remains speculative without exact data. The support zone at $52.56 has held in previous pullbacks and represents a multi-month low area. If the stock continues to slide, traders will watch for a potential test of this level. Resistance near $58.10 has been respected in recent attempts to rally, suggesting that overhead supply exists. Volume during the current session does not indicate a decisive breakout in either direction. The narrowing trading range over the past few weeks may signal that volatility is compressing, which often precedes a larger move. For now, the price action remains consistent with a stock that is consolidating between defined boundaries.

Looking ahead, Fortis could see several potential scenarios unfold. If the stock continues to weaken and breaks below the $52.56 support level, it may open the door to a test of lower price zones not seen since prior periods of market stress. Conversely, if the current level holds and buying interest emerges, a move back toward the $58.10 resistance level could be possible over time. Factors that may influence future performance include shifts in interest rate policy, as utilities are sensitive to changes in the bond market. An unexpected dovish stance from central banks could renew demand for yield-oriented equities, potentially benefiting FTS. Additionally, the company’s upcoming earnings announcements or regulatory updates could serve as catalysts. On the fundamental side, Fortis’s regulated utility model provides relatively predictable cash flows, which may attract investors during periods of uncertainty. However, persistent inflation or higher-for-longer interest rates could continue to weigh on the sector. Overall, the stock appears to be in a wait-and-see pattern, with the $52.56 support and $58.10 resistance providing the key boundaries that will define the next directional move.
